This is an advanced technique in the treatment of thyroid diseases thanks to the advantage of not leaving scars and ensuring maximum aesthetics for the patient.

Doctors at Vietnam - Sweden Uong Bi Hospital apply TOETVA technique - transoral thyroid endoscopy for patients.
According to the Vietnam-Sweden Uong Bi Hospital, the TOETVA method uses three small incisions in the oral mucosa, allowing the doctor to access the thyroid gland without making any incisions in the neck area. As a result, the patient after surgery has no external scars, less pain, less bleeding and a faster recovery than with traditional open surgery.
Currently, this technique has been mastered by hospital doctors and is routinely performed in many cases, especially in young people because of its aesthetic properties and avoidance of scarring after treatment.
Dr. Uong Hong Hop, Head of the Department of Otorhinolaryngology, said: This technique is suitable for patients with benign thyroid nodules, moderately sized tumors, or Basedow's disease who are indicated for surgery.
Through this, hospital doctors recommend that people should get checked early when unusual symptoms such as difficulty swallowing, feeling a lump in the neck or prolonged hoarseness appear. Timely diagnosis and intervention help increase treatment effectiveness and limit complications.
